I am facing an issue with SourceTree (on Windows) merge. In the Log/History tab, I am able to see the two parents that were used in the merge. But the Log/History tab shows only the files that were affected by one parent. How can I see the files that were changed by the second parent in the merge? Am I missing something here?
There is an option at tools\options\git\"show file changes from all sides of a merge". This will change the way the diff is displayed.
